u/congratz_its_a_bunny Black Belt Picker 12d ago

I'm pretty sure all Schlage Everest locks have the little triangle mountain thing on the front. Since yours doesn't have that, I would bet it's a Schlage Primus (brown) - not a Schlage Everest Primus nor a Schlage Everest 29 SL Primus XP

2

u/JessTheMullet White Belt Picker 12d ago

Everest, even the primus variants as far as I know, all have the little triangle and the warding has a spot for that portion of the key, which I'm not seeing here. I think it's the brown belt Primus.

u/Red_wanderer Black Belt 6th Dan 12d ago

The 29 SL Primus is both newer and very rare (schlage botched the sales of them and very few locksmiths bought into the systems). I also believe they have both PRIMUS and the triangle on them. With the condition and only the word PRIMUS here, this is almost assuredly a brown belt Primus.

You can tell by the keys as well, if you have them.
